>From your description, this only happens at 100% CPU load. If that is correct, this sounds like the system is just not cooling well enough. It could be a bad/inadequate fan, an insufficient heatsink, bad case airflow, etc. There is a program called CPUburn that will give you instant 100% load and push the CPU temp as hard as possible. I would suggested Googling for that, I use it for stress-testing my watercooled box when I do overclocking experiments. That will give you an on-demand way to cause temperature rise. Then I'd check the system and see if it's actually dropping the fan RPM or if the stock HSF set is just not up to the task. I've seen off-the-shelf name-brand systems that were actually not capable of running 100% load full-time due to poor case design/layout. Mini-ITX fanless boards are a good example of this. I use sensors just by loading the modules and checking the /sys files, although that requires knowing the chips and what the driver code puts into each file entry.
